From the following passages you can see that the Word and anything
from it that is used in the church or in any worship is God’s name:


From the rising of the sun my name will be invoked. (Isaiah 41 : 25 )
From the rising of the sun to the setting of it, great is my name among
the nations. In every place incense is offered to my name. But you des-
ecrate my name when you say, “Jehovah’s table is defiled.” And you
sneeze at my name when you bring offerings that are stolen, lame, and
sick. (Malachi 1 : 11 , 12 , 13 )
All peoples walk in the name of their God; we walk in the name of
Jehovah our God. (Micah 4 : 5 )
They are to worship Jehovah in one place, the place where he will put
his name (Deuteronomy 12 : 5 , 11 , 13 , 14 , 18 ; 16 : 2 , 6 , 11 , 15 , 16 ),

that is, where Jehovah will locate their worship of him.


Jesus said, “Where two or three are gathered together in my name, I am
there in the midst of them.” (Matthew 18 : 20 )
As many as received him, he gave them power to be children of God, if
they believed in his name. (John 1 : 12 )
Those who do not believe have already been judged because they have
not believed in the name of the only begotten Son of God. (John 3 : 18 )
Those who believe will have life in his name. (John 20 : 31 )
Jesus said, “I have revealed your name to people and have made your
name known to them.” (John 17 : 26 )
The Lord said, “You have a few names in Sardis.” (Revelation 3 : 4 )
There are also many passages similar to these in which the name of
God means the divine quality which radiates from God and through
which he is worshiped.
The name of Jesus Christ, however, means everything related to his
redeeming humankind and everything related to his teaching, and there-
fore everything through which he saves. “Jesus” means all his efforts to
save the human race through redemption; “Christ” means all his efforts
to save the human race through teaching.
